Output 39ed78b30591ddd791dfa58fe3f707d50262193821671573e6d9f58fcb99934b:0

value
119689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b18dafde6c26af97ceb3884ad6c18ca14a395de OP_EQUAL
address
3QahJgM7W7LSE2TtYbvTsZwuzpnTjgKfTS
transaction
39ed78b30591ddd791dfa58fe3f707d50262193821671573e6d9f58fcb99934b